Due to the increase in the number of administrative cases under Art. 20.3 of the Code of Administrative Offenses (propaganda and public demonstration of Nazi symbols and symbols of banned organizations), we combine such cases into a single list for each month.
On January 27, 2021, the Promyshlenny District Court of Orenburg fined A. 1,000 rubles for publishing in the public domain on his page on the social network VKontakte a video with flags depicting the flags of Nazi Germany. A. fully admitted his guilt, repented of his deed. The court took into account remorse for what he had done, young age. The subject of the administrative offense (phone) was not confiscated.
On January 22, 2021, the Luninsky District Court of the Penza Region fined a local resident M. 1,000 rubles for publishing a Nazi swastika in the public domain on the Odnoklassniki social network. M posted a group photo of a man with a swastika tattoo. In court, M. fully admitted his guilt in committing an offense. In sentencing, the court took into account the circumstances mitigating administrative responsibility, which include admission of guilt, remorse for the deed, young age, marital status, the presence of a dependent minor child.
On January 26, 2021, the Kukmorsky District Court of Tatarstan fined Burkhanova, a resident of the district, 15,000 rubles for publishing a video on the social network, which, "according to the conclusions of experts set out in the expert study report of the FBU Sredne-Volzhsky RCSE of the Ministry of Justice of Russia, contains linguistic and psychological signs of justifying violent, destructive actions against groups identified on the basis of their relationship to religion (non-Muslims, Muslims who do not observe the canons of Islam), signs of a threat to commit actions aimed at the physical destruction of law enforcement officers, etc., ". The court took into account "the confession of guilt, advanced age and financial situation of Burkhanova.
On January 25, 2021, it became known that in the Voronezh Region, the Ertilsky District Court fined a local resident for two thousand rubles for January 13, 2021, who published an image of the banned ISIS flag on his VKontakte page.
On January 26, 2021, it became known that in the Moscow Region, the Istra City Court fined a 26-year-old resident of the Voskhod urban district for posting photos and videos with Nazi symbols on his VKontakte page.
On January 25, 2021, the prosecutor's office of the Kirovsky district of Saratov fined a local resident for posting on the VKontakte social network an image " used in the symbols of the state, military and political institutions of Nazi Germany in 1933-1945 ."
On January 20, 2021, it became known that in Kalmykia, a court fined a local resident who, on his VKontakte page under the pseudonym Sanan Ulanov, published a photo with people dressed “in military uniform with a chevron of the Russian Liberation Army.” Above this photo was located "the official image of the flag of the Russian Federation." Unfortunately, we do not know what kind of material we are talking about, therefore we cannot assess the legality of the persecution of a resident of Kalmykia.
On January 19, 2021, Evgeniy Kutseba was punished for posting an image of a swastika on the VKontakte social network. The Kemerovo District Court of the Kemerovo Region fined him 2,000 rubles.
On January 12, 2021, the Kemerovo District Court fined Aleksey Yutkin, a prisoner in FKU IK-22 of the GUFSIN of the Kemerovo Region, for showing a tattoo depicting a Nazi swastika on his arm, 1,000 rubles.
On January 13, 2021, the Center "E" of the Main Directorate of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Russia for the Kemerovo Region announced that a 16-year-old teenager was punished for distributing Nazi symbols on social networks. An administrative protocol was drawn up against the offender, however, since the teenager had not yet reached the age of 18, the protocol was transferred to the commission for minors and the protection of their rights of the administration of the Zavodskoy district of the city of Kemerovo. The commission imposed a punishment on the minor in the form of an administrative fine in the amount of 1,000 rubles. In addition, it will be put on a preventive account.
At the beginning of 2021, in the Vologda Oblast, a court fined a prisoner in the colony in Gryazovets for showing other convicts tattoos (hands, fingers, shoulder) with Nazi symbols.
